28 Jan 2026Betelgeuse, a red giant star 400-600 light-years away, is nearing supernova. Its brightness significantly dimmed in 2019-2020, coinciding with a powerful planetary alignment. While the cause of the dimming is uncertain, it suggests instability and a potential supernova event.Beetlejuice, a massive star, is nearing the end of its life and could go supernova within 100,000 years. Its unusual characteristics include rapid rotation, a strong magnetic field, and a recent significant dimming event. The dimming could be due to a gas bubble ejection or a massive sunspot, but the exact cause remains a mystery.
